What is a Craft Club Subscription Box?

A craft club subscription box is a monthly subscription service that delivers curated DIY craft kits to subscribers' doorsteps. Each box typically contains all the materials and instructions needed to complete a specific craft project or multiple projects. The kits cover a wide range of crafts, such as painting, embroidery, paper crafting, and jewelry making, catering to various interests and skill levels.

How to Paint and Assemble the B-Truck Kit

The B-Truck kit in Box 1 offers a fun painting and assembly project that allows you to create an adorable bee-themed truck decoration. Here's a step-by-step guide on how to bring your B-Truck to life:

1. Painting the Truck

Start by painting the wooden truck base using the Silver Lining chalk paint from Waverly. Apply one good coat of paint to the entire truck, excluding the tires and mirror insides. For the tires, use black chalk paint, and for the mirror insides, use white chalk paint. To add a weathered and rustic look to the truck, use a dry brush and Waverly wax in antique. Dry brush the wax around the entire truck, focusing on the edges and middle to give it a rusted and dirty appearance.

2. Adding Rust and Weathering Effects

To enhance the rustic look of the truck, use a chip brush to dry brush more Waverly wax in antique throughout the middle of the truck. This creates the illusion of rust and dirt, giving it an old and worn aesthetic.

3. Painting Details and Accents

Using the Chocolate or Paste in Bumble Bee paint mixed with a bit of Water, paint the "Buzz" license plate and the bees on the tailgate. Carefully go around the engravings and paint the rest of the areas yellow. For intricate details, such as the bee's body or wings, use small paintbrushes or markers. Additionally, paint the honey jars with a green color to add a pop of freshness to the truck's design.

4. Assembling the Truck

Once all the painting is complete, it's time to assemble the truck. Use wood glue or super glue to attach the back bumper, tail light plates, and bed rails. If you added scrapbook paper to the honey jars, make sure to glue them down before adding the Second bed rail. Finish off the truck with some black paint pen details to add an extra touch of cuteness and definition.

Using Scrapbook Paper on the Honey Jars

If you choose to add scrapbook paper to the honey jar pieces, follow these simple steps:

  1. Cut out pieces of scrapbook paper that match the Shape and size of the honey jar areas.
  2. Apply Mod Podge or a similar adhesive to the back of the paper and adhere it to the honey jar.
  3. To prevent wrinkles, place a piece of parchment paper on top of the paper and use a mini Cricut heat press to activate the adhesive.
  4. Once dry, remove the parchment paper, and your honey jars will have a vibrant and personalized touch.

Painting and Assembling the Additional Kit

The additional kit in Box 3 provides an opportunity to create beautiful floral and bee-themed crafts. Here's a step-by-step guide on how to paint and assemble the additional kit:

1. Painting the Florals and Greenery

Begin by painting the leaves on the floral pieces with the Aloe Green paint from Americana. This vibrant green color brings life to the foliage, creating a fresh and natural look. For the flowers, use a mixture of Eggshell Blue and the two shades of yellow provided, allowing you to create dimensional and visually appealing floral accents.

2. Adding Details to the Flowers and Hive

To add depth and definition to the floral pieces, use a very detailed paintbrush and black chalk paint to create fine lines and slashes on the leaves and flowers. This additional detail work brings the pieces to life and adds an extra touch of elegance.

3. Assembling the Pieces

Assemble the floral pieces on top of each other, alternating the flowers and leaves to create a visually striking arrangement. Glue them down using wood glue or super glue, making sure to secure each piece firmly. Once the floral arrangement is complete, place the beehive in the center, and add any additional bees around the sign for added Charm.
